Decanter Australia and New Zealand Fine Wine Encounter

The Landmark Hotel, London.
Tasted Saturday, May 21, 2005 by Vinoguy with 1,425 views

Introduction

Brief impressions of the wines tasted during a short walk around the two main tasting rooms.

Flight 1 - A few wines from New Zealand (4 Notes)

  • 2002 Jackson Estate Riesling 89 Points

    New Zealand, South Island, Marlborough

    Perfumed nose of lemons and limes. Dry with a pleasant mouth feel and medium weight body. Good concentration with fresh acidity and a nice finish.

  • 2003 Jackson Estate Pinot Noir 88 Points

    New Zealand, South Island, Marlborough

    Attractive Pinot nose. Medium bodied, nice fruit flavours – a little simple but pleasant. Finishes a little short.

  • 2004 Nautilus Estate Sauvignon Blanc 90 Points

    New Zealand, South Island, Marlborough

    Gooseberry and freshly cut grass explode from the glass on the nose and palate. Nicely balanced. Good value at UK9.99. 89 – 90.

  • 2004 Nautilus Estate Pinot Noir 88 Points

    New Zealand, South Island, Marlborough

    A sweet nose of berry fruit and a hint of tobacco. Quite an “elegant” palate but with a short finish. At UK14.99 it’s over priced in my opinion. The nose earns it a generous 88/100.

Flight 2 - Australian whites (3 Notes)

  • 2003 Plantagenet Chenin Blanc 87 Points

    Australia, Western Australia, South West Australia, Mount Barker

    Orange peel and zest on a light and fresh nose. Medium bodied with flavours of orange peel and hints of lemon. Perhaps lacking a little acidity. Pleasant but unremarkable.

  • 2004 Delta Vineyard Pinot Noir 88 Points

    New Zealand, South Island, Marlborough

    Appealing nose of ripe fruit and light wood. A medium weight, flavoursome if simple palate with a hint of mixed dried spices. I was interested to learn that this was the first vintage of this wine, from newly planted vines, and was made using 40% new oak. A good debut.

Flight 3 - Australian reds (22 Notes)

  • 2000 Wolf Blass Shiraz Platinum Label 94 Points

    Australia, South Australia, Barossa, Barossa Valley

    Poured from a newly opened bottle. Tightly closed classic Shiraz nose. Rich and powerful dark berry fruits with pepper and spice on the palate. Intense and brooding with superb balance and structure and a wonderfully long and lingering finish. Young with great potential.

  • 2001 Penfolds Shiraz RWT 92 Points

    Australia, South Australia, Barossa, Barossa Valley

    Deep purple / black core; classic Shiraz nose. Sweet, fat and intense but this is no fruit bomb – the mid palate shows good balance and structure, lots of pepper but surprisingly little oak. Good length. Nice but I’m not sure this warrants its hefty price tag.

  • 1996 Wynns Coonawarra Estate Cabernet Sauvignon John Riddoch 92 Points

    Australia, South Australia, Limestone Coast, Coonawarra

    Almost black and showing no signs of age. The nose is surprisingly quite mute. It shows a medium weight, restrained and youthful palate with all of the typical qualities one would expect of a good Cabernet. Well balanced with a nice but not remarkable finish. This still has a lot of potential.

  • 2003 Mitolo Shiraz G.A.M. 90 Points

    Australia, South Australia, Fleurieu, McLaren Vale

    Black core with a surprisingly mute nose. The intensity of the fruit on the palate is almost overwhelming – an archetypal Aussie fruit bomb with a generous lashing of black pepper and hints of tobacco on a very long finish. Some people I know would love this but it’s too much for my tastes. A very subjective 90/100 points.

  • 2000 Yalumba The Signature 95 Points

    Australia, South Australia, Barossa, Barossa Valley

    The quality of the 2000 Yalumba wines is very impressive. The nose is intense and rich with cassis, plums with spice and finely integrated oak. The palate is powerful and brooding, harmoniously balanced and superbly structured. The finish is long and intense. One of the best wines today. Excellent. 95+

  • 1991 St Hallett Shiraz Old Block 92 Points

    Australia, South Australia, Barossa

    Classic nose of black fruits, hints of pepper, spice, earth and gamey aromas. The palate is full, rounded and integrated, well balanced with black berries, lots of pepper and a long finish. It’s noticeably aged but still has plenty of life left in it yet. 92+
